In this prospective study, we tested the hypothesis if E2 and P serum levels significantly differ during the luteal phase following in vitro-fertilization/intracytoplasmic sperm injection (IVF/ICSI) therapy in conception (CC) versus non-conception (NC) cycles, and their potential in the prediction of pregnancy at the earliest point in time. Serum was sampled from the day of embryo transfer (ET) and throughout the luteal phase until ET + 14 from patients consecutively enrolling for IVF/ICSI therapy. The luteal phase was supported by vaginal P suppositories only, clinical pregnancies were detected by ultrasound and followed up until the 20th week. Overall pregnancy rate was 30.9% constituting the two study groups of CC (n = 22) and NC cycles (n = 49). Significantly, higher E2 (3326 ± 804 versus 1072 ± 233 pmol/l, p = 0.014) and P (244 ± 68 versus 73 ± 10 nmol/l, p = 0.023) were present in CC versus NC from as early as ET + 7. In the CC group, patients with ongoing pregnancies (CC-OG) as compared with miscarriages (CC-MC) had significantly higher E2 and P from ET + 7, predicting ongoing pregnancy in receiver operator characteristics analysis.

The term 'luteal phase deficiency' was first coined more than 60 years ago, and, since then, it has been suggested as a clinical entity per se and an aetiological factor for subfertility, implantation failure and recurrent miscarriage. Despite the existing recommendations for rational work-up in subfertility, luteal phase evaluation and progesterone therapy alone is still common in daily practice. This review comprises results from a Pubmed literature search with the terms 'luteal phase' and 'subfertility', focussing on clinical situations not primarily related to assisted reproduction techniques. Additional data from the experimental studies published in the past 10 years on follicular maturation, oocyte developmental competence and the ovulatory cascade are integrated into the clinical continuum of dysfunctional ovulation, menstrual cycle irregularity and impaired corpus luteum function. As reliable diagnostic tools for adequate luteal function are missing, the presence of clinical symptoms such as cycle irregularity or premenstrual spotting is indicative and should initiate early follicular phase diagnostic work-up. New evidence on the interdependence of oocyte and follicular maturation and resulting developmental competence of the embryo further support the use of ovarian stimulation as the first-line therapeutic option in different subsets of patients with subfertility including luteal phase deficiency.

The study was designed to evaluate in vitro the cellular mechanisms of the single nucleotide polymorphism (SNP) p.N680S of the FSH receptor gene (FSHR) in human granulosa cells (GC) and included patients homozygous for the FSHR SNP (NN/SS) undergoing ovarian stimulation. GC were isolated during oocyte retrieval and cultured for 1­7 days. Basal oestradiol and progesterone concentrations were measured after short-term culture. The kinetics of cAMP, oestradiol and progesterone concentrations in response to various amounts of FSH were analysed in a 6­7 day culture. Basal oestradiol, but not progesterone, concentrations on day 1 of GC culture, were significantly higher in NN compared with SS (P = 0.045), but non-responsive to FSH stimulation. Immunofluorescence microscopy demonstrated the re-appearance of FSHR expression with increasing days in culture. Upon stimulation with FSH, GC cultured for 6­7 days displayed a dose-dependent increase of cAMP, oestradiol and progesterone but no difference in the EC50 values between both variants. Primary long-term GC cultures are a suitable system to study the effects of FSH in vitro. However, the experiments suggest that factors down-stream of progesterone production or external to GC might be involved in the clinically observed differences in an FSHR variant-mediated response to FSH.

Androgens and insulin are endocrine key players in the pathophysiology of polycystic ovary syndrome (PCOS), a heterogenic condition of unexplained etiology and a suspected genetic background. Androgens mediate the clinical phenotype of the disease. Therefore,all criteria of the recent PCOS consensus definition are based on their biological effects. Insulin resistance, followed by compensatory hyperinsulinemia, is frequently found in patients with PCOS. Insulin resistance is correlated with a risk of metabolic complications of PCOS, and recent research has focused on possible long-term health consequences of the syndrome. Newest molecular genetic findings at the receptor level of both androgens and insulin support their pivotal role in PCOS. These results could help to better characterize the heterogenic disorder, enabling a refinement of existing individualized therapeutic strategies.

BACKGROUND: Exposure to bacterial antigens and other environmental factors in combination with a genetic susceptibility have been implicated in the etiology of inflammatory bowel disease (IBD). As certain perinatal circumstances, e.g., delivery by cesarean section, predispose to a different intestinal colonizations the aim of this analysis was to define a potential influence on the development of IBD in later life. METHODS: In a case-control study design, birth data were recorded from patients diagnosed with IBD (Crohn's disease [CD], n = 1,096; ulcerative colitis [UC], n = 763) and healthy controls ([C], n = 878) by a self-administered questionnaire. RESULTS: Preterm birth (CD: odds ratio [OR] 1.5 [95% confidence interval 1.1-2.0], UC: OR 1.3 [0.9-1.9]), mother's disease during pregnancy (CD: OR 1.9 [1.3-2.9], UC: OR 1.6 [1.0-2.4]), and disease in the first year of life (CD: OR 2.2 [1.6-2.9], UC: OR 1.7 [1.3-2.3]) are associated with the development of IBD in later life. No significant associations were found for the mode of delivery and breast feeding. In a logistic regression analysis female sex, smoking, appendectomy, maternal IBD, and disease in the first year of life were independently associated with CD. Female sex, appendectomy, and disease in the first year of life were independently associated with UC. CONCLUSIONS: Preterm birth and other perinatal circumstances are associated with the development of IBD, of which disease in the first year of life is an independent risk factor in multivariate analysis.

BACKGROUND: In mice, anti-Müllerian hormone (AMH) inhibits primordial follicle recruitment and decreases FSH sensitivity. Little is known about the role of AMH in human ovarian physiology. We hypothesize that in women AMH has a similar role in ovarian function as in mice and investigated this using a genetic approach. METHODS: The association of the AMH Ile(49)Ser and the AMH type II receptor (AMHR2) -482 A > G polymorphisms with menstrual cycle characteristics was studied in a Dutch (n = 32) and a German (n = 21) cohort of normo-ovulatory women. RESULTS: Carriers of the AMH Ser(49) allele had higher serum estradiol (E(2)) levels on menstrual cycle day 3 when compared with non-carriers in the Dutch cohort (P = 0.012) and in the combined Dutch and German cohort (P = 0.03). Carriers of the AMHR2 -482G allele also had higher follicular phase E(2) levels when compared with non-carriers in the Dutch cohort (P = 0.028), the German cohort (P = 0.048) and hence also the combined cohort (P = 0.012). Women carrying both AMH Ser(49) and AMHR2 -482G alleles had highest E(2) levels (P = 0.001). For both polymorphisms no association with serum AMH or FSH levels was observed. CONCLUSIONS: Polymorphisms in the AMH and AMHR2 genes are associated with follicular phase E(2) levels, suggesting a role for AMH in the regulation of FSH sensitivity in the human ovary.

PURPOSE: To study effects of endogenous LH levels on ovarian response and outcome in ART cycles a controlled study was performed with two patient groups differing in the intensity of pituitary downregulation. METHODS: Group I (n = 27) received 3.75 mg of the GnRH agonist triptorelin acetate depot, group II (n = 54) was given 0.1 mg triptorelin acetate daily, followed by ovarian stimulation with recombinant FSH. RESULTS: After downregulation serum LH and FSH levels were significantly lower in group I. Patients of group I needed significantly higher FSH doses to achieve comparable levels of serum estradiol and preovulatory follicles. The number of retrieved oocytes and transferable embryos was lower in group I. CONCLUSION: Patients with profound endogenous LH suppression by depot GnRH agonists show higher FSH stimulation dose requirements and lower oocyte number and fertilization rate, indicating a need for minimal LH activity in folliculogenesis and oocyte development.

The p.N680S sequence variation of the follicle-stimulating hormone (FSH) receptor gene was previously shown to influence the ovarian response to FSH in normo-ovulatory women undergoing controlled ovarian hyperstimulation. In this prospective, randomized, controlled study, we tested whether the same daily dose of FSH results in lower levels of oestradiol in women homozygous for the p.N680S sequence variation, and whether the difference can be overcome by higher FSH doses. Women undergoing controlled ovarian hyperstimulation for in vitro fertilization or intracytoplasmic sperm injection and homozygous for the wild-type or for the p.N680S FSH receptor were randomly assigned to group I (Ser/Ser, n=24), receiving an FSH dose of 150 U/day, or group II (Ser/Ser, n=25), receiving an FSH dose of 225 U/day. In group III (Asn/Asn, n=44), the FSH dose was 150 U/day. Age and basal FSH levels were not different between groups. At ovulation induction, total FSH doses were comparable in group I (1631+/-96 U) and group III (1640+/-57 U) but significantly higher in group II (2421+/-112 U) (P<0.001). Peak oestradiol levels on the day of human chorionic gonadotrophin (hCG) administration were significantly lower in group I (5680+/-675 pmol/l) compared to group III (8679+/-804 pmol/l) (P=0.028). Increasing the FSH dose from 150 to 225 U/day overcame the lower oestradiol response in women with Ser/Ser (group II, 7804+/-983 pmol/l). In women undergoing controlled ovarian hyperstimulation, the p.N680S sequence variation results in lower oestradiol levels following FSH stimulation. This lower FSH receptor sensitivity can be overcome by higher FSH doses.

From 1998 to 2003, 133 Caucasian women aged 17-40 years (median 29 years) suffering from unexplained recurrent miscarriage (uRM) were consecutively enrolled. In patients and 133 age-matched healthy controls prothrombotic risk factors (factor V (FV) G1691A, factor II (FII) G20210A, MTHFR T677T, 4G/5G plasminogen activator inhibitor (PAI)-1, lipoprotein (Lp) (a), protein C (PC), protein S (PS), antithrombin (AT), antiphospholipid/anticardiolipin (APA/ACA) antibodies) as well as associated environmental conditions (smoking and obesity) were investigated. 70 (52.6%) of the patients had at least one prothrombotic risk factor compared with 26 control women (19.5%; p<0.0001). Body mass index (BMI; p=0.78) and smoking habits (p=0.44) did not differ significantly between the groups investigated. Upon univariate analysis the heterozygous FV mutation, Lp(a) > 30 mg/dL, increased APA/ACA and BMI > 25 kg/m(2) in combination with a prothrombotic risk factor were found to be significantly associated with uRM. In multivariate analysis, increased Lp(a) (odds ratio (OR): 4.7/95% confidence interval (CI): 2.0-10.7), the FV mutation (OR:3.8/CI:1.4-10.7), and increased APA/ACA (OR: 4.5/CI: 1.1-17.7) had independent associations with uRM.

Previous studies have demonstrated the potential significance of Endothelin (ET)-1 and its receptors, ETAR and ETBR, in the development and progression of breast cancer. The objective of this study was to assess the expression levels and potential regulation of the "ET axis" in human non-neoplastic and neoplastic breast tissue as well as in various human breast cancer cell lines. Expression of ET-1, ETAR and ETBR was evaluated in 31 neoplastic and 7 non-neoplastic breast tissue samples and in six human breast cancer cell lines using conventional and quantitative real-time RT-PCR, Western blotting and immunohistochemistry. The effects of 17beta-estradiol (E2) and cobalt-chloride (CoCl2) treatment on ET-1, ETAR and ETBR expression were studied in vitro. ETAR mRNA expression levels were found to be statistically significantly higher in breast cancer specimens than in non-neoplastic breast tissue (p<0.001). For ET-1 and ETBR mRNA expression, no significant difference was observed between the two groups. All cell lines exhibited expression of ET-1 and ETAR mRNA, whereas none showed significant ETBR mRNA expression. We observed a strong and reproducible induction of ETAR mRNA and protein expression by E2 and CoCl2 in MDA-MB-468 and BT-474 cells and in MDA-MB-453 and SK-BR-3 cells with a maximum increase after 8 and 16 h of treatment, respectively, while MCF-7 and HBL-100 cells showed a constitutive expression pattern. The present data suggest a novel mechanism in the regulation of ETAR expression in breast cancer. Based on these findings, a combination of ETAR-antagonists with adjuvant endocrine treatment seems to be a reasonable therapeutic strategy.

PURPOSE: To study the association of inhibin B with ovarian response to FSH stimulation, applying either GnRH agonist or antagonist. METHODS: In a prospective randomized controlled trial, 46 patients undergoing COH received either triptorelin (group I, n = 15) or ganirelix (group II, n = 31). Parameters of follicular response and inhibin B serum levels were assessed. RESULTS: Inhibin B before FSH stimulation was significantly lower in group I than group II. The FSH stimulation phase was significantly longer in group I than group II, and the total FSH dose was significantly higher with a comparable number of retrieved oocytes. Day 1 inhibin B in group I, but not group II, was significantly correlated with the number of large ovarian follicles and retrieved oocytes. In group II, but not group I, inhibin B on day 1 was inversely correlated with the daily and total FSH dose as well as FSH stimulation duration. CONCLUSIONS: The association of inhibin B serum levels with parameters of follicular response in COH is different in patients assigned to GnRH agonist vs. antagonist treatment protocols.
